Selection Process: The USA Basketball Men's Collegiate Committee will invite approximately 35 athletes,
18-years-old or younger (born on or after 1/1/90), to the USA U18 National Team Trials.

Assuming USA Basketball applies FIBA regulations, then U-18 means 18 yrs old and under/younger. So, if the tournament is in 2008, the player should be born on or after 01 Jan 1990.
